Detoxification is the first step of getting off of drugs and alcohol, and you may choose to undergo detox in a hospital inpatient facility for a few re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Augusta offers medically supervised detox, which is performed with the help of nurses and doctors who can make drug withdrawal more comfortable, utilizing medications to alleviate symptoms and even make detox safer. Someone withdrawing from alcohol for example might need specific medications during detox to prevent seizures and tremors that are common with serious alcohol withdrawal. Someone who is suffering with he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al might choose to take part in medical detox in a hospital inpatient facility, where prescription medications are used to ease them through a very uncomfortable (but usually not life threatening) form of withdrawal. Individuals in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ility remain at the facility until the withdrawal symptoms have gone away. This may be anywhere from 5 days to 2 weeks depending on what drug they are detoxing from and their overall physical and mental health.

For an individual who has been struggling with substance abuse issues for some time, there would ideally be a quick and easy transition from a hospital inpatient detoxification facility to a drug recovery program to work on their addiction because detox is not actual treatment in itself.
